A Sea To Sky Gondola day pass transports you 885 metres above the Howe Sound to a winter playground where one can connect with the great outdoors. Enjoy snowshoeing or tubing at the summit and finish the experience off with a warming fondue at The Summit Lodge restaurant. www.seatoskygondola.com

So it Is: Vancouver, an unusual coffee table book that captures the untold stories of Vancouver. The book features 100 portraits and snippets about Vancouver from the eyes of billion dollar business men like Ryan Holmes and Chip Wilson, to colourful figures like “Canada’s most famous junkie,” Dean Wilson, a Downtown Eastside legend. www.soitisvancouver.com
